try-catch – c# ¿Cuándo validar o cuándo lanzar una excepción?

Cuando lanzar una excepción
Cuando lanzar una excepción

Seguir leyendo

Anuncios

throw vs throw ex ¿Cuál crees que no debes usar?

Si alguna vez te has puesto a pensar ¿Qué debo usar un throw o throw ex? y no sabias que elegir entonces te recomiendo que leas este post.
public void Tarea()
{
    try
    {
        //Ocurre una excepción
    }
    catch (Exception ex)
    {
        //Envio Mail
        //Log de errores
        //Etc
        //¿throw o throw ex;? 
    } 
 } 

Seguir leyendo